Much research has been carried out on biohydrometallurgy over these last 25 years and is still being actively conducted all over the … Hydrometallurgy is a technique within the field of extractive metallurgy, the obtaining of metals from their ores. Hydrometallurgy involve the use of aqueous solutions for the recovery of metals from ores, concentrates, and recycled or residual materials. Processing techniques that complement hydrometallurgy are pyrometallurgy, vapour metallurgy, and molten salt electrometallurgy. Hydrometallurgy is typically divided into three general areas:

WebOct 18, 2003 · An early documented commercial application of a biohydrometallurgy process in the mining industry was for copper extraction from mine waste (Zimmerley et al. 1958). The acidophilic iron oxidizing Thiobacillus ferrooxidans was recognized as a means to maintain iron in the oxidized ferric form to serve as the oxidant for sulfide copper … WebFeb 2, 2024 · What is biohydrometallurgy?
